My 2000 3/4 ton automatic has developed a slipping in and out of lock-out that 3 trans. technitions have thrown parts at to no avail. A new TPS , a new shift kit, and a transmition flush. Nothing is showing up on the "computer" they use to detect problems. It goes to a new dealer shop today. What do you guys think? :confused:
 
depending on how many miles, and what you`ve done with it in those miles, its possible the torque converter lockup clutch may be bad. . If it isnt some kind of computer problem thats causing the lockup solenoid to release, its probably the lockup clutch plates worn down... if you do a lot of towing, particularly in lock up at low rpm, that can eat em up. .

Sounds like the old electrical noise spikes problem. Do a search - many posts on this. Call DTT for a noise filter.
 
Bill,



Mine was doing the same thing. Like Tom said contact DTT for the noise filter - worked for me - cheapest fix so far. I think about $35 + my time 1/2 hour to install. It's been on going on 9 months now.
